Where this album fits

Career context
By the time 'Wincing the Night Away' was released in January 2007, The Shins were riding high on the success of their previous album, 'Chutes Too Narrow', which had solidified their place in indie rock. This third studio album marked a significant evolution in their sound, showcasing more complex arrangements and a broader sonic palette as they sought to build on their earlier acclaim.
